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/414.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 使用socket.io-stream节点包通过套接字io将文件从服务器发送到客户端(浏览器)_Javascript_Socket.io_Stream_Socketstream - Fatal编程技术网

Javascript 使用socket.io-stream节点包通过套接字io将文件从服务器发送到客户端(浏览器)

Javascript 使用socket.io-stream节点包通过套接字io将文件从服务器发送到客户端(浏览器),javascript,socket.io,stream,socketstream,Javascript,Socket.io,Stream,Socketstream,我正在尝试使用socket.io-stream包从socket io服务器接收文件。我收到一个流,但如何将该流下载到文件中。该文件可以是任何格式。有没有办法做到这一点,因为浏览器js没有fs包。我读到可能会有一个斑点,但不知道怎么做 <script> $(function () { var socket = io(); ss(socket).on('file', function(stream, data) { **/

我正在尝试使用socket.io-stream包从socket io服务器接收文件。我收到一个流,但如何将该流下载到文件中。该文件可以是任何格式。有没有办法做到这一点,因为浏览器js没有fs包。我读到可能会有一个斑点,但不知道怎么做

<script>
      $(function () {
        var socket = io();

        ss(socket).on('file', function(stream, data) {
          **//stream.pipe(fs.createWriteStream(filename));**
         });

      });
    </script>

$(函数(){
var socket=io();
ss(socket).on('file',函数(流,数据){
**//stream.pipe(fs.createWriteStream(文件名))**
});
});